
Cycle Through America's First National Park! Located in Wyoming, Montana, and Idaho, it is home to grizzly bears, wolves, bison, elk, Old Faithful, and a collection of the world's most extraordinary geysers and hot springs.
Starting in Red Lodge, Montana, we'll ride into Yellowstone via the Beartooth Scenic Byway, called "America's Most Beautiful Highway." Once inside we'll ride to Old Faithful, do a loop inside Grand Teton National Park, then ride out the east entrance of Yellowstone to Cody, Wyoming, and then back into Montana along the Chief Joseph Scenic Byway. In the course of the week we'll cycle through 2 National Parks and 2 Scenic Byways!
